Simple python script to obtain CUDA device information
#!/usr/bin/env python
#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""
Outputs some information on CUDA-enabled devices on your computer,
including current memory usage.
It's a port of https://gist.github.com/f0k/0d6431e3faa60bffc788f8b4daa029b1
from C to Python with ctypes, so it can run without compiling anything. Note
that this is a direct translation with no attempt to make the code Pythonic.
It's meant as a general demonstration on how to obtain CUDA device information
from Python without resorting to nvidia-smi or a compiled Python extension.
Author: Jan Schlüter
"""
import sys
import ctypes
# Some constants taken from cuda.h
CUDA_SUCCESS = 0
C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_MULTIPROCESSOR_COUNT = 16
C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_MAX_THREADS_PER_MULTIPROCESSOR = 39
C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_CLOCK_RATE = 13
C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_MEMORY_CLOCK_RATE = 36
def ConvertSMVer2Cores(major, minor):
# Returns the number of CUDA cores per multiprocessor for a given
# Compute Capability version. There is no way to retrieve that via
# the API, so it needs to be hard-coded.
# See _ConvertSMVer2Cores in helper_cuda.h in NVIDIA's CUDA Samples.
return {(1, 0): 8, # Tesla
(1, 1): 8,
(1, 2): 8,
(1, 3): 8,
(2, 0): 32, # Fermi
(2, 1): 48,
(3, 0): 192, # Kepler
(3, 2): 192,
(3, 5): 192,
(3, 7): 192,
(5, 0): 128, # Maxwell
(5, 2): 128,
(5, 3): 128,
(6, 0): 64, # Pascal
(6, 1): 128,
(6, 2): 128,
(7, 0): 64, # Volta
(7, 2): 64,
(7, 5): 64, # Turing
}.get((major, minor), 0)
def main():
libnames = ('libcuda.so', 'libcuda.dylib', 'cuda.dll')
for libname in libnames:
try:
cuda = ctypes.CDLL(libname)
except OSError:
continue
else:
break
else:
raise OSError("could not load any of: " + ' '.join(libnames))
nGpus = ctypes.c_int()
name = b' ' * 100
cc_major = ctypes.c_int()
cc_minor = ctypes.c_int()
cores = ctypes.c_int()
threads_per_core = ctypes.c_int()
clockrate = ctypes.c_int()
freeMem = ctypes.c_size_t()
totalMem = ctypes.c_size_t()
result = ctypes.c_int()
device = ctypes.c_int()
context = ctypes.c_void_p()
error_str = ctypes.c_char_p()
result = cuda.cuInit(0)
if result != CUDA_SUCCESS:
cuda.cuGetErrorString(result, ctypes.byref(error_str))
print("cuInit failed with error code %d: %s" % (result, error_str.value.decode()))
return 1
result = cuda.cuDeviceGetCount(ctypes.byref(nGpus))
if result != CUDA_SUCCESS:
cuda.cuGetErrorString(result, ctypes.byref(error_str))
print("cuDeviceGetCount failed with error code %d: %s" % (result, error_str.value.decode()))
return 1
print("Found %d device(s)." % nGpus.value)
for i in range(nGpus.value):
result = cuda.cuDeviceGet(ctypes.byref(device), i)
if result != CUDA_SUCCESS:
cuda.cuGetErrorString(result, ctypes.byref(error_str))
print("cuDeviceGet failed with error code %d: %s" % (result, error_str.value.decode()))
return 1
print("Device: %d" % i)
if cuda.cuDeviceGetName(ctypes.c_char_p(name), len(name), device) ==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" Name: %s" % (name.split(b'\0', 1)[0].decode()))
if cuda.cuDeviceComputeCapability(ctypes.byref(cc_major), ctypes.byref(cc_minor), device) ==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" Compute Capability: %d.%d" % (cc_major.value, cc_minor.value))
if cuda.cuDeviceGetAttribute(ctypes.byref(cores), C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_MULTIPROCESSOR_COUNT, device) ==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" Multiprocessors: %d" % cores.value)
print(" CUDA Cores: %s" % (cores.value * ConvertSMVer2Cores(cc_major.value, cc_minor.value) or "unknown"))
if cuda.cuDeviceGetAttribute(ctypes.byref(threads_per_core), C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_MAX_THREADS_PER_MULTIPROCESSOR, device) ==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" Concurrent threads: %d" % (cores.value * threads_per_core.value))
if cuda.cuDeviceGetAttribute(ctypes.byref(clockrate), C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_CLOCK_RATE, device) ==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" GPU clock: %g MHz" % (clockrate.value / 1000.))
if cuda.cuDeviceGetAttribute(ctypes.byref(clockrate), CU_DEVICE_ATTRIBUTE_MEMORY_CLOCK_RATE, device) ==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" Memory clock: %g MHz" % (clockrate.value / 1000.))
result = cuda.cuCtxCreate(ctypes.byref(context), 0, device)
if result != CUDA_SUCCESS:
cuda.cuGetErrorString(result, ctypes.byref(error_str))
print("cuCtxCreate failed with error code %d: %s" % (result, error_str.value.decode()))
else:
result = cuda.cuMemGetInfo(ctypes.byref(freeMem), ctypes.byref(totalMem))
if result == CUDA_SUCCESS:
print(" Total Memory: %ld MiB" % (totalMem.value / 1024**2))
print(" Free Memory: %ld MiB" % (freeMem.value / 1024**2))
else:
cuda.cuGetErrorString(result, ctypes.byref(error_str))
print("cuMemGetInfo failed with error code %d: %s" % (result, error_str.value.decode()))
cuda.cuCtxDetach(context)
return 0
if __name__=="__main__":
sys.exit(main())
